How they compare
Poland currently reports 46.12 against 45.54 in Lithuania, a difference of 0.58.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 31 shared years of data; in 1996 it was Poland ahead.
Lithuania ranks 12th and Poland ranks 10th of 27 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Lithuania averaged higher in 2 and Poland in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lithuania | Poland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 18.36 | 28.28 | 9.92 | Poland |
| 2000s | 59.81 | 58.88 | 0.929 | Lithuania |
| 2010s | 48.84 | 55.2 | 6.36 | Poland |
| 2020s | 48.2 | 44.56 | 3.65 | Lithuania |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
